I have the Rapala knife that has all the different hook ups supplied. You can use a wall plug, alligator clips on a Vex battery, or the cigarette lighter in the boat or truck. Plus it has a long and short set of blades; love it for its versatility.

For a cordless I would definitely go with the rapala cordless. I had a couple other off brands and could not clean a limit of walleyes on a charge. The rapala comes with two batteries and I can easily clean a limit of eyes on one battery. Actually I have cleaned a limit of eyes, crappies and a few perch on one battery.
